  • the present invention relates to a device for connecting a handle to a door or window wing, having the characteristics defined in the introduction to claim 1.
  • the invention also relates to a method for installing a handle on a door or window wing.
  • Handles to be installed on doors or windows are generally provided in association with a connection device enabling them to be fixed to the door or window wing.
  • a connection device of known type comprises a support element rotatably engaged on an end portion of the handle and provided with centering blocks to be inserted into respective centering seats formed in the door or window wing. Threaded fixing elements engaged through said blocks then fix the support element to the wing.
  • the support element incorporates an elastic return device acting on the handle to return this to a rest position following its operation.
  • An aesthetic finishing element commonly known in the sector as a "rosette” can also be removably applied to the support element.
  • the aesthetic finishing element is generally directly screwed onto the support element after the connection device, together with the handle, have been fixed to the wing.
  • connection device is very bulky in relation to its packaging, being necessarily combined with the handle.
  • Handles provided with such devices are also difficult to install.
  • the operator has to rotate the handle and maintain it in a position enabling a screwdriver to gain access to screw the threaded fixing elements down, while the elastic means tend to return the handle to its rest position.
  • the concept of a handle permanently combined with its connection device limits the dimensions and shape of the handle itself in that, in order to mount the aesthetic finishing element on the device support element, the aesthetic finishing element has to be slid along the body of the handle until it reaches the support element. Consequently the handle cannot have dimensions greater than the central aperture in the finishing element.
  • connection devices have been proposed in which the aesthetic finishing element is permanently engaged with the handle and is combined with the elastic return device for returning the handle to its rest position following its operation.
  • a plate-like support element presenting centering blocks to be fitted into respective seats provided in the wing and engage respective threaded fixing elements.
  • the plate-like support element is also provided with elastic locking elements which snap-insert into the finishing element when this is thrust against the support element.
  • This device is also of relatively high production cost, mainly related to the plate-like support element.
  • this device does not provide for any interchangeability of the aesthetic finishing element as this is permanently associated with the handle.
  • a further known connection device produced by the same applicant, comprises overall a main support element combined with an elastic return device for returning the handle into a rest position, and an auxiliary support element to be engaged on the main support element and removably carrying an aesthetic finishing element.
  • main support element and the auxiliary support element when the main support element and the auxiliary support element are fitted together they form a support block which is fixed to the wing by threaded elements.
  • the handle is inserted via its end portion through an aperture provided through the main and auxiliary support elements, to operationally engage the elastic return device.
  • the handle end portion which engages the elastic return device is slid along a bar of square cross-section projecting from the wing for the purpose of operating the lock controlled by the handle.
  • the handle is fixed by a threaded grub screw acting on the bar of square cross-section.
  • the main object of the present invention is to solve the problems of the known art by providing a connection device which is easier to mount, is of lower production cost and of smaller overall size for packaging, in addition to offering wide freedom of choice in the appearance of the handle and finishing element.
  • a device for connecting a handle to a door or window wing having the characteristics defined in the characterising part of claim 1.
  • the invention also proposes a new method for installing a handle on a door or window wing, having the characteristics defined in claim 11.
  • the reference numeral 1 indicates overall a device for connecting a handle to a door or window wing in accordance with the present invention.
  • the device 1 comprises at least one support element 2 presenting a fixed portion 3 to be engaged with a door or window wing 4 and a movable portion 5 rotatably engaged with the fixed portion 3.
  • the fixed portion 3 is substantially of disc shape and comprises a central region 8 and a peripheral region 9 circumscribing the central region 8.
  • a first through aperture 10 and a circular housing seat 11 for rotatable engagement by the movable portion 5.
  • Substantially cylindrical centering blocks 12 project from the peripheral region 9 preferably in diametrically opposite positions.
  • Each centering block 12 presents a through longitudinal hole 13 engagable by a respective threaded element 14 for fixing the support element 2 against the wing 4.
  • the movable portion 5, substantially of disc shape is rotatably inserted in the housing seat 11 and presents centrally a second through aperture 15, perimetrally bounded by an inner circumferential wall 16.
  • the inner circumferential wall 16 extends through the first through aperture 10 of the fixed portion 3 and presents a terminal edge 17 bent outwards to define first locking means 6 operating between the fixed portion 3 and the movable portion 5 to maintain these latter axially joined together.
  • the bent terminal edge 17 in fact constrains the movable portion 5 to the fixed portion 3 such as to allow only relative rotations between the fixed portion 3 and the movable portion 5 about the axis of the through apertures 10, 15.
  • the movable portion also presents an outer perimetral wall 18 extending concentrically to the circumferentially inner wall 16.
  • the outer circumferential wall 18 extends through only a circular arc of the entire outer circumferential extension of the movable portion 5, to consequently define a first active edge 18 and a second active edge 20 interacting with elastic return means 7 to counteract, at least in one direction, the rotations of the movable portion 5.
  • the elastic return means 7 preferably consist of a torsional spring 21 extending about the first through aperture 10 of the fixed portion 3.
  • the torsional spring 21 is maintained constantly preloaded by a pair of shoulders 22 provided in the fixed portion 3 and projecting into the circular housing seat 11 towards the movable portion 5.
  • engagement elements 23 extend from the peripheral region 9 of the fixed portion 3 in the opposite direction to the direction in which the centering blocks 12 extend in order to provide direct engagement, ie without the presence of any intermediate element, between the support element 2 and a finishing element 24 represented by dashed lines.
  • the engagement elements 23 are circumferentially distributed at an outer circumferential seat of the peripheral region 9 and act by interference against a wall of the finishing element 24 in order to maintain this latter rigidly engaged with the support.
  • the device 1 also comprises coupling means 25 operationally associated (or rigid) with the movable portion 5 of the support 2 and engagable with a terminal portion 26 of a gripping handle 27 (shown by dashed lines in Figure 1) to maintain this latter rotationally rigid with the movable portion 5.
  • the coupling means 25 are defined by a pair of lugs 28a projecting from the inner circumferential wall 16 of the movable portion 5 towards the centre of the through apertures 10, 15, to slidingly engage in respective seats provided in the terminal portion 26 of the handle 27 when this latter is associated with the support element 2.
  • the device 1 also comprises second locking means 28 associated with the movable portion 5 of the support element 2 and arranged to engage the terminal portion 26 of the handle 27 and maintain this latter axially fixed to the support element.
  • the second locking means 28 comprise at least one substantially disc-shaped insert 29 fixed to the movable portion 5 of the support element 2.
  • the insert 29 presents at least one coupling portion 30 arranged to snap-engage a respective coupling seat 31 consisting for example of a circular groove provided in the terminal portion 26 of the handle 27.
  • the insert 29 presents four coupling portions 30 extending radially from the insert towards the centre of the through apertures 10, 15.
  • Each coupling portion 30 presents an active edge having at least one part 32 of substantially rounded profile and at least one part 33 of substantially rectilinear profile following the rounded part 32 ( Figure 3).
  • the rounded part 32 of each coupling portion 30 facilitates its insertion whereas the rectilinear part 33 interacts with the counteracting edge 34 of the coupling seat 31 to maintain the insert 29 and handle 27 joined together.
  • the insert 29 presents internally a cylindrical collar 35 in which a circumferential notch 36 is provided preferably having a V-shaped profile which defines in the collar one or more elastically yieldable portions 36a carrying at their ends the coupling portions 30.
  • the portions 36a extend in a direction substantially parallel to the geometrical axis of the through apertures 10, 15, to thus be elastically yieldable in a radial direction to facilitate radial contraction of the coupling portions 30 during insertion of the terminal portion 26 of the handle 27.
  • the insert 29 and the movable portion 5 of the support element 2 have been shown as separate elements. It should however be noted that in another embodiment, not shown, the coupling portions 30 are formed in one piece with the movable portion 5, in the absence of any insert 29.
  • the support element 2 When the device 1 is to be applied to the wing 4, the support element 2 is firstly centered by inserting the centering blocks 12 of the fixed portion 3 into the centering seats provided in the wing 4. The threaded fixing elements 14 are then inserted through the through holes 13 of the centering block 12 and screwed into the wing, to fix the support element 2 against this latter. The finishing element 24 is then rigidly applied by pressing it onto the support element 2, after which the terminal portion of the handle 27 is inserted into the through apertures 10, 15 and pushed towards the wing. In this situation, the coupling portions 30 of the insert 29 snap into the coupling seat 31 to lock the handle 27 against the support element 2.
  • the terminal portion 26 of the handle 27 is advantageously able to interact, via a shoulder 27a thereof, with the second locking means 28 to axially retain the finishing element 24 engaged on the support element 2.
  • the present invention attains the stated objects.
  • the device is practical and easy to mount in that the operator has merely to fix the support element by screwing it to the door or window wing and lock the handle onto the support element by a simple thrust action.
  • the handle Once the handle has been fixed on the support element it is simple for the operator to screw the threaded grub screw to fix the bar of square cross-section usually provided for operating the lock controlled by the handle.
  • connection device separate from the handle allows considerable reduction in overall dimensions, especially in relation to the packaging of these elements.
  • the device conceived in this manner has the advantage of enabling different finishing elements to be mounted at choice, hence allowing easy interchangeability.
  • the handle can be produced in any desired shape and size.
  • the device of the present invention is of lower production cost than known devices.
  • the device does not use auxiliary support elements for associating the handle with the wing or for associating a finishing element with the handle.
  • the handle can be fixed to the wing and the finishing element to the handle by means of a single support element.
